>> hfn> I wanna ask about snmptrap, how can i do snmptrap for some oid ? for
>> hfn> example, could snmptrap used for sending information about my disk
>> hfn> usage (oid .1.3.6.1.2.1.25.2.3.1.6.1) to another NMS software ?
>>
>> hfn> if it's possible, how do i write it ? because everytime i search on
>> hfn> internet, the example will always include with uptime oid.
>>
>> traps can be sent using any OID you can dream of.  Many network
>> management software packages, however, need specific legally defined
>> trap OIDs to properly process them on the other side.
>>
>> Our receiver (snmptrapd) can receive anything and log anything it
>> receives.  It may be more useful to use real trap oids though.
